Northern Nevada Public Health has provided an update to respiratory illness numbers in the region.
Washoe County is showing an increase in flu and RSV cases, with more cases of the flu now than there were at this time last year.
Flu activity remains elevated while RSV cases continue to rise and COVID-19 activity remains low, in the latest weekly update.
While flu activity remains high in northern Nevada, hospitalizations are continuing to decline.
